Ingredients and Preparation

Essential Ingredients and Possible Substitutions

To make these delightful Funfetti Cornbread Muffins, you’ll want to gather a few essential ingredients. Here’s what you need:

  • Cornmeal: This provides the signature texture. You can use either yellow or white cornmeal based on your preference.
  • All-purpose flour: This adds structure and helps with the perfect rise.
  • Baking powder: The key leavening agent for fluffy muffins.
  • Salt: To balance and enhance the flavors.
  • Sugar: Granulated sugar sweetens the cornbread; feel free to use less if you prefer a drier texture.
  • Eggs: They help bind the ingredients together while adding richness.
  • Milk: Whole milk is preferred for that creamy texture, but any milk will do!
  • Butter: Melted butter gives that lovely richness. You can substitute with vegetable oil if you’re looking for a lighter option.
  • Funfetti sprinkles: These colorful little gems bring the magic!

If you need substitutions, no worries! You can swap in almond flour or gluten-free flour for a gluten-free version. For a dairy-free option, choose almond milk and coconut oil instead of butter. Feel free to play with flavors by adding spices like cinnamon or nutmeg for an extra twist.

Step-by-Step Recipe Instructions with Tips

Now, let’s dive into the step-by-step process to bring these delightful Funfetti Cornbread Muffins to life:

  1. Preheat the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C) and lining a muffin tin with paper liners or greasing it with a little butter.

  2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the cornmeal, all-purpose flour, baking powder, sugar, and salt. Whisk everything together until it’s nicely blended.

  3. Combine Wet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s and then add the milk and melted butter. This helps create a smooth batter.

  4. Blend Together: Pour the wet ingredients into the dry mixture. Stir just until combined—be careful not to overmix! A few lumps are okay.

  5. Add Funfetti Sprinkles: Gently fold in the colorful sprinkles, saving a handful to sprinkle on top before baking for that extra festive flair.

  6. Fill and Bake: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about two-thirds full. Sprinkle the remaining Funfetti on top for a pop of color. Bake for about 18–20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.

  7. Cool and Enjoy: Once baked, let them cool in the tin for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ely. Serve warm slathered with butter or enjoy them as they are!

Cooking Techniques and Tips

How to Cook Funfetti Cornbread Muffins Perfectly

Creating the perfect Funfetti Cornbread Muffins comes down to a few simple techniques. Always remember to measure your ingredients carefully—too much flour can lead to dry muffins. Mixing your dry and wet ingredients separately helps ensure you create a beautifully fluffy texture. Also, avoid overmixing the batter. A few lumps are perfectly fine and help keep the muffins light and airy.

Another tip is to keep an eye on your bake time; every oven is a little different. Pull the muffins out as soon as a toothpick comes out clean. If you enjoy a more crusty muffin top, try letting them bake a minute or two longer, but don’t let them dry out!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

While making Funfetti Cornbread Muffins is relatively straightforward, there are a few common pitfalls to avoid. First and foremost, don’t skip the baking powder; it’s essential for that lift. Also, remember that an overly hot oven can cause the muffins to rise too quickly, leading to cracks on top.

Allow the muffins to cool in the pan for just a few minutes before transferring them. If you remove them too early, they may crumble and break apart. Lastly, save some sprinkles for decoration—the joy of these muffins comes from their colorful appearance!

How do I store leftover Funfetti Cornbread Muffins?

Store your leftover mu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you live in a particularly humid area, you might want to refrigerate them to prolong freshness.

Can I freeze Funfetti Cornbread Muffins?

Absolutely! Wrap the cooled muffins individually in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can last up to 2–3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y them, simply thaw at room temperature or warm them gently in the oven.

Funfetti Cornbread Muffins


  • Author: joe
  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 12 muffins 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Delightful and colorful Funfetti Cornbread Muffins, perfect for any occasion.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up cornmeal
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 1/2 cup melted butter
  • 1/2 cup Funfetti sprinkles (plus more for topping)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and prepare a muffin tin with liners.
  2. In a large bowl, combine cornmeal, flour, baking powder, sugar, and salt; whisk together.
  3. In another bowl, whisk the eggs, then add milk and melted butter.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ry mixture and stir until just combined.
  5. Gently fold in the Funfetti sprinkles, saving some for the top.
  6. Spoon the batter into the muffin tin, filling each cup two-thirds full, and sprinkle the remaining sprinkles on top.
  7.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
  8. Let cool in the tin for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

For a dairy-free version, swap out milk for almond milk and use coconut oil instead of butter.
